Understanding the Core Mechanics of the Chicken Game
At its heart, the chicken game is a game of incomplete information and strategic maneuvering. Typically played with two players, the game’s central concept revolves around a simulated scenario: two drivers speeding towards each other. The first driver to swerve is deemed the “chicken,” conceding defeat. However, if neither driver swerves, a catastrophic collision occurs, resulting in losses for both. This seemingly simple premise creates a fascinating dynamic rooted in game theory and psychological prediction.
The brilliance of the chicken game lies in the balance of risk and reward. A brave player, unwavering in their resolve, stands to win substantially. However, presuming their opponent will also remain steadfast can lead to a devastating outcome. Predicting your competitor’s behavior, assessing their risk tolerance, and understanding the potential consequences are all critical components of successful gameplay. This makes it a game attractive to those who enjoy both strategic thinking and a little bit of a gamble.
